Panasonic just showed their lasted digital camera: Lumix DMC-L1. it's a rangefinder feel digital SLR, equiped with Lecia lenses(14-50, f2.8-3.5, IS lens!), and shared some parts with Olympus's E330:the the four-third system, anti-dust sensor(7mega-pixel, with some modification by Panasonic), and most importanly, it looks like a traditional camera, even a rangefinder.
